WebNov 11, 2024 · During an attack or flare, some of the common symptoms include: Swelling Intense pain Redness Tenderness (from the slightest touch) Stiffness and Warmth On average, the gout attack would last for about two weeks or more, depending on the severity of the condition. Surprisingly, in-between the flares one may not have any symptoms. Web1 hour ago · Certain types of arthritis like gout are triggered by a surplus of uric acids in the joints. Once provoked, the acids coalesce into sharp crystals that can trigger painful flare-ups. litcharts a tale of two cities https://ayscas.net

WebOsteoarthritis causes the cartilage in your hip joint to become thinner and the surfaces of the joint to become rougher. This can cause swelling, pain and stiffness, but not everyone will have these symptoms. The exact cause of osteoarthritis is often not known, as there can be quite a few reasons why a person develops the condition.
